7. Why is bullying more prominent (stands out) today then in the past?

Explanation

Bullying is more prominent today than in the past because of the way technology is so ever present. With the rise of social media platforms and the constant use of cell phones, bullies now have more avenues to target their victims. The internet allows for anonymity, making it easier for bullies to harass others without facing consequences. Additionally, the widespread use of technology means that bullying can happen anytime and anywhere, making it difficult for victims to escape. This increased accessibility and reach of technology has contributed to the prominence of bullying in today's society.

10. What does previewing an article mean?

Explanation

Previewing an article means examining the article's title, pictures, and other elements before starting to read it. This allows the reader to get an overview of the content and helps in determining whether the article is of interest or relevant. By previewing, readers can also make predictions about the article's content and activate their prior knowledge, which aids in comprehension and engagement with the text.
